Boosting the Performance of Transformer Architectures for Semantic Textual Similarity

Semantic textual similarity is the task of estimating the similarity between the meaning of two texts. In this paper, we fine-tune transformer architectures for semantic textual similarity on the Semantic Textual Similarity Benchmark by tuning the model partially and then end-to-end. We experiment with BERT, RoBERTa, and DeBERTaV3 cross-encoders by approaching the problem as a binary classification task or a regression task. We combine the outputs of the transformer models and use handmade features as inputs for boosting algorithms. Due to worse test set results coupled with improvements on the validation set, we experiment with different dataset splits to further investigate this occurrence. We also provide an error analysis, focused on the edges of the prediction range.
